Output c818ca9565964de0bb5be85e867ac75a3a2987834e99221020c59460a7408318:0

value
511326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e3f5c1f637c92e18c924b6488ff0c5bb364bb44 OP_EQUAL
address
3QsMTb61BqNizSFbdAFeh3rzZFRqtCdQaM
transaction
c818ca9565964de0bb5be85e867ac75a3a2987834e99221020c59460a7408318
spent
true